What Does 246 Mean?
Reviewed by vending machine technicians · Last updated July 18, 2026
Quick Answer
246 = Elevator Position Error — the product elevator (picker mechanism) failed to reach its home position or the position sensor is reporting an incorrect vertical coordinate, preventing product delivery

Step-by-Step Troubleshooting
- Power cycle the machine — the elevator will attempt a homing sequence on startup and may recover if the position was lost due to a transient sensor glitch
- Inspect the elevator carriage for physical obstructions — a product that fell behind the elevator tray blocks vertical movement
- Check the elevator position sensor (optical or magnetic encoder strip) for dust, debris, or misalignment — a dirty sensor reports incorrect position data
- Verify the elevator drive belt tension — a slipping belt causes the motor to turn without moving the elevator, resulting in a position mismatch

Frequently Asked Questions
How serious is Crane error 246?
Severity: RED. Elevator Position Error — the product delivery elevator cannot determine its position. This error locks the machine and requires immediate attention as no products can be dispensed until resolved.
Can I fix Crane error 246 myself?
Start by power cycling the machine — this forces an elevator homing sequence that resolves many transient position errors. If the error recurs, check for physical obstructions in the elevator path. The position sensor cleaning and belt adjustment can be done by experienced route operators. If the encoder strip or motor needs replacement, contact a qualified vending technician.
What parts do I need for Crane error 246?
Common parts include the elevator drive belt ($20-40), position sensor or optical encoder strip ($30-60), and elevator carriage guide rails ($15-25). Always diagnose the specific cause before ordering parts — the error code alone does not tell you which component has failed.
